Ballycummin, Raheen, Co. Limerick
Retention of a car parking area and four sheds for valet and carwash facilities in Raheen.

Development description
- A new vehicle parking area for approved used stock of circ. 0.1395 hectares and accommodating
- No car parking spaces to the rear (south) of the existing car park and retention permission of 4 no. Shed structures with a total floor area of 429 sq. Metres accommodating valet, carwash and car turntable facilities and permission for the completion of the vehicle parking area to include site lighting and all ancillary site works
